摘要
Religion has been distinguished from "magic" for the solidarity ties allegedly offered by the former, but not the latter, which by contrast is claimed to emphasize individual needs. However, the contemporary "alternative" or "countercultural" spiritual network (e.g., New Age, Neo-Paganism) utilizes beliefs and practices that could be described as magic, while still offering social solidarity. Excerpta from in-depth interviews with 22 alternative spiritualists illustrate how the strain between individuality and community is addressed. Shared ideology across individuals suggests that alternative spirituality is a contemporary social movement, in which protest against social control is voiced more through communication codes than overt political action. Thus, expression of individuality paradoxically becomes a source of solidarity. This movement reflects large-scale tensions in complex societies regarding individuality versus community. Therefore, "magic," when enacted in a complex society, deals with many of the same social strains as religion or other social institutions.
